Bible Verses About Journey of Israel Through The Desert
Key Bible Verses
But lusted exceedingly in the wilderness, And tempted God in the desert.
And he gave them their request, But sent leanness into their soul.
They envied Moses also in the camp, AndAaron the saint of Jehovah.
The earth opened and swallowed up Dathan, And covered the company of Abiram.
And a fire was kindled in their company; The flame burned up the wicked.
They made a calf in Horeb, And worshipped a molten image.
Thus they changed their glory For the likeness of an ox that eateth grass.
They forgat God their Saviour, Who had done great things in Egypt,
Wondrous works in the land of Ham, And terrible things by the Red Sea.
Therefore he said that he would destroy them, Had not Moses his chosen stood before him in the breach, To turn away his wrath, lest he should destroythem.
Yea, they despised the pleasant land, They believed not his word,
But murmured in their tents, And hearkened not unto the voice of Jehovah.
Therefore he sware unto them, That he would overthrow them in the wilderness,
And that he would overthrow their seed among the nations, And scatter them in the lands.
They joined themselves also unto Baal-peor, And ate the sacrifices of the dead.
Thus they provoked him to anger with their doings; And the plague brake in upon them.
Then stood up Phinehas, and executed judgment; And so the plague was stayed.
And that was reckoned unto him for righteousness, Unto all generations for evermore.
They angered him also at the waters of Meribah, So that it went ill with Moses for their sakes;
Because they were rebellious against his spirit, And he spake unadvisedly with his lips.
They did not destroy the peoples, As Jehovah commanded them,
But mingled themselves with the nations, And learned their works,
And served their idols, Which became a snare unto them.
Yea, they sacrificed their sons and their daughters unto demons,
And shed innocent blood, Even the blood of their sons and of their daughters, Whom they sacrificed unto the idols of Canaan; And the land was polluted with blood.
